Eyeglass manufacturing involves multiple precise processes, from design to final assembly. Whether producing optical eyewear frames, sunglasses, or safety eyewear, factories follow a structured workflow to ensure quality, durability, and visual accuracy. Below is a detailed breakdown of the key steps in eyeglass production.
Concept Development: Designers create sketches or 3D models based on fashion trends, ergonomics, and functional requirements.
Digital Modeling: CAD (Computer-Aided Design) software refines the frame shape, size, and hinge mechanisms.
Prototype Testing: A physical sample is 3D-printed or handcrafted for fit, comfort, and style evaluation.
Common frame materials include:
Acetate (plant-based plastic) – Lightweight, hypoallergenic, and available in various colors.
Metal Alloys (stainless steel, titanium, aluminum) – Durable and corrosion-resistant.
TR-90 (flexible nylon) – Impact-resistant, ideal for sports eyewear.
Wood/Bamboo – Eco-friendly but requires specialized treatment.
Sheet Cutting: Raw acetate sheets are laser-cut into rough frame shapes.
Milling & Engraving: CNC machines carve out the frame design, including hinge slots and lens grooves.
Tumbling & Polishing: Frames are placed in a vibrating drum with polishing compounds to smooth edges.
Hand-Finishing: Artisans buff and polish details manually for a premium finish.
Wire Cutting & Bending: Metal wires are shaped into temples and front frames.
Welding/Jointing/Tumbling/Polishing: Laser welding connects hinges and bridge components. And then tumbling / hand-polishing to ensure a smooth surface.
Electroplating: Frames are coated (e.g., gold, silver, gunmetal) for aesthetics and rust prevention.
Cleaning & Protection: Lenses are cleaned, and frames are put into a polybag to prevent scratches.
Labeling & Certification: Includes branding, model number, and regulatory compliance marks (CE, FDA).
Distribution: Packaged eyeglasses are shipped to eyewear retailers or directly to eyeglasses consumers.
